Furthermore, the stahflity of such dispersions is pH dependent. In fact, many of them (except PVAc dispersions) coagulate in neutral or acidic conditions, leading to the failure of the adhesive system. This can he avoided hy the addition of neutralizing agents such as ammonium hydroxide or alkali hydroxides with pH values in the range of 9-10. [Pg.929]

Suspension Polymerization. At very low levels of stabilizer, eg, 0.1 wt %, the polymer does not form a creamy dispersion that stays indefinitely suspended in the aqueous phase but forms small beads that setde and may be easily separated by filtration (qv) (69). This suspension or pearl polymerization process has been used to prepare polymers for adhesive and coating appHcations and for conversion to poly(vinyl alcohol). Products in bead form are available from several commercial suppHers of PVAc resins. Suspension polymerizations are carried out with monomer-soluble initiators predominantly, with low levels of stabilizers. Suspension copolymerization processes for the production of vinyl acetate—ethylene bead products have been described and the properties of the copolymers determined (70). Continuous tubular polymerization of vinyl acetate in suspension (71,72) yields stable dispersions of beads with narrow particle size distributions at high yields. [Pg.465]

Fillers (calcium carbonate, calcium sulfate, aluminum oxide, bentonites, wood flour) increase the solid content of the dispersion. They are added up to 50%, based on PVAc. The purpose of the addition is the reduction of the penetration depth, provision of thixotropic behavior of the adhesive, gap filling properties and the reduction of the costs. Disadvantage can be the increase of the white point and a possible higher tool wear. [Pg.1078]

Nevertheless, the adhesives formulated with PVAc-based polymer dispersions suffer from some drawbacks. Due to the high poly(vinyl acetate) thermoplasticity the adhesive joints obtained with PVAc-based formulations are sensitive to high temperatures and have a poor resistance to creep under static load. Moreover, the presence of poly (vinyl alcohol) (PVA), used as protective colloid in the emulsion polymerization phase, makes them also easily affected by both moisture and water. [Pg.329]

The PVAc formulations currently available on the adhesives market are rather complex systems comprising a poly(vinyl acetate) dispersion, a film forming promoter, a cross-linking agent and/or a hardener. The use of modified poly(vinyl acetate) dispersions generally requires a thermal treatment to obtain the best results and the use of a specific cross-linking comonomer, such as N-methylolacrylamide (NMA), may cause a lower shelf-life of adhesives as well as formaldehyde emissions. [Pg.329]
